OK - I have a work around and that is to drop my 3.3GB hibernate file. I don't
like this as I've just spent a lot of time getting it into 1 extent. This works
 and I am now trialling Libreoffice but finding problems.

Would this space check problem be removed if Libreoffice used an exe file to
install instead of an msi file????


Some FYI.

This space check problem seems to be an going problem with quite a lot of
comment on thee internet. Came across this fix from Microsoft which should help
with people on vista and above and using MSI installer 4.5. It was released in
May 2010 so I should imagine it is well a truly implemented on Vista and above
now. Unfortunately no equivalent for  XP and MSi installer 3.1! Please pass
this information on to interested parties.
http://support.microsoft.com/kb/2028841
"Out of disk space" error when you install a Windows Installer package in
Windows Server 2008 or in Windows Vista if Windows Installer 4.5 is installed
A supported hotfix is available from Microsoft. etc etc
